Sanguszko carpets

Sanguszko carpets is a group of 16th-17th centuries Safavid Kerman carpets. They are named after the Polish prince Roman Sanguszko who was owner of an excellent example of these Kerman carpets.

Detail of the 16th century Persian Safavid period Kerman carpet owned by Roman Sanguszko. The carpet is now in the Miho Museum, Japan. (Exhibition ‘The Magnificent Sanguszko Carpets’ in Genoa)
